Employers and Clients. Every year your employer is required to submit an all-time of the wages and taxation that they take away from your gross pay. This information is reported to you and the federal, state, and local tax agencies on Form W-2. Likewise, if you perform function as an independent contractor, revenue that get is reported to tax authorities on Form 1099. You can request a duplicate from employers and clients.
